索引的优点和缺点 一、为什么要创建索引呢(优点)? 这是因为,创建索引可以大大提高系统的性能。 第一, 通过创建唯一性索引,可以保证数据库表中每一行数据的唯一性。 第二, 可以大大加快数据的检索速度,这也是创建索引的最主要的原因。 第三, 可以加速表和表之间的连接,特别是在实现数据的参考完整性方面特别有意义。 第四, 
转载
2023-07-10 13:42:22
77阅读
Redis Cluster是Redis的分布式解决方案, 在3.0版本正式推出, 有效地解决了Redis分布式方面的需求。 当遇到单机内存、 并发、 流量等瓶颈时, 可 以采用Cluster架构方案达到负载均衡的目的。 之前, Redis分布式方案一般有两种: ·客户端分区方案, 优点是分区逻辑可控, 缺点是需要自己处理数据路由、 高可用、 故障转移等问题。 ·代理方案, 优点是简化客户端分布式逻
转载
2023-08-15 16:53:30
226阅读
Redis Cluster 核心技术Redis Cluster 是 redis的分布式解决方案,在 3.0版本正式推出 当遇到单机、内存、并发、流量等瓶颈时,可以采用 Cluster 架构方案达到负载均衡目的。 Redis Cluster 之前的分布式方案有两种:
1)客户端分区方案,优点分区逻辑可控,缺点是需要自己处理数据路由,高可用和故障转移等。
2) 代理方案,优点是简化客户端分布式逻辑和升
转载
2023-07-08 18:06:13
235阅读
Redis 集群模式简述一个集群模式的官方推荐最小最佳实践方案是 6 个节点,3 个 Master 3 个 Slave 的模式,如 图00 所示。key 分槽与转发机制Redis 将键空间分为了 16384 个槽,通过以下算法确定每一个 key 的槽:CRC16(key) mod 16384由于 16384 = 2 的 14 次方,对一个 2 的 n 次方取余相当于对于它的 2 的 n 次方减一取
转载
2023-08-22 10:05:57
0阅读
什么是redis clusterredis cluster是redis作者自己提供的集群化方案redis cluster是redis的分布式解决方案,在3.0版本正式推出,有效的解决了redis分布式方面的需求。当遇到分区内存、并发、流量等瓶颈时,可以采用cluster架构方案达到负载均衡的目的。之前,redis分布式方案一般有两种:客户端分区方案,优点是分区逻辑可控,缺点是需要自己处理数据路由、
转载
2023-08-30 10:13:45
9阅读
## Redis Cluster的优缺点
Redis Cluster是一个分布式的Redis集群解决方案,它可以在多个节点之间分布数据,提高Redis的性能和可用性。在实际应用中,Redis Cluster有其独特的优点和缺点,下面我们将对其进行介绍。
### 优点
1. **高可用性**:Redis Cluster支持主从复制和故障转移,当某个节点发生故障时,系统可以自动将主节点切换为从节
原创
2024-03-10 03:32:00
158阅读
原文:https://www.centos.bz/2017/12/mariadb-galera-cluster%E9%9B%86%E7%BE%A4%E4%BC%98%E7%BC%BA%E7%82%B9/一、MariaDB Galera Cluster概要1.简述:MariaDB Galera Cluster 是一套在mysql innodb存储引擎上面实现multi-master及数据实时同步的系
转载
2019-05-31 23:38:34
1358阅读
点赞
MariaDB Galera Cluster集群优缺点
转载
2021-07-30 15:16:26
651阅读
一、MariaDB Galera Cluster概要:1.简述:MariaDB Galera Cluster 是一套在mysql innodb存储引擎上面实现multi-master及数据实时同步的系统架构,业务层面无需做读写分离工作,数据库读写压力都能按照既定的规则分发到 各个节点上去。在数据方面完全兼容 MariaDB 和 MySQL。2.特性:(1).同步...
转载
2022-04-11 15:29:26
1249阅读
一、MariaDB Galera Cluster概要:1.简述: MariaDB Galera Cluster 是一套在mysql innodb存储引擎上面实现multi-master及数据实时同步的系统...
转载
2017-11-30 16:54:00
111阅读
2评论
一、MariaDB Galera Cluster概要:1.简述:MariaDB Galera Cluster 是一套在mysql innodb存储引擎上面实现multi-master及数据实时同步的系统架构,业务层面无需做读写分离工作,数据库读写压力都能按照既定的规则分发到 各个节点上去。在数据方面完全兼容 MariaDB 和 MySQL。2.特性:(1).同步...
转载
2021-08-10 10:08:58
1124阅读
一些总结:1. 多线程对同一个 Key 操作时, Redis 服务是根据先到先作的原则,其他排队(可设置为直接丢弃),因为是单线程。 2. 修改默认的超时时间,默认 2 秒。但是大部份的操作都在 30ms 以内。3. 对集群来说,3.1 一般来说普通的服务器都是 50K~100K 级别 GET 操作并发(每个核心)这个水平,根据具体的部署方法和配套工具,会有浮动 对本机的普通
转载
2023-09-27 09:49:51
87阅读
Redis集群是Redis提供的分布式数据库方案,集群通过分片来进行数据共享,并提供复制和故障转移功能。Redis cluster特点:1、在线水平扩容能力2、Failover能力和高可用性 3、架构简单:无中心架构,各个节点度等。slave节点提供数据冗余,master节点异常时提升为master。相对于使用Proxy三层架构,系统复杂度降低,且可节约大量的硬件资源;架构层次减少,提升读写性能
转载
2023-10-25 23:03:29
66阅读
# MySQL Cluster 的缺点及实现
MySQL Cluster 是 MySQL 的一个分布式数据库解决方案,具备高可用性和可扩展性。但它也存在一些缺点。在本篇文章中,我将指导你如何识别和实现 MySQL Cluster 中的不同缺点。我们将分步骤进行,最终汇总成一个系统的理解。
## 实现流程
下面是实现 MySQL Cluster 缺点的步骤流程:
| 步骤 | 描述
MyISAM:这个是默认类型,它是基于传统的ISAM类型,ISAM是Indexed Sequential Access Method (有索引的顺序访问方法) 的缩写,它是存储记录和文件的标准方法.与其他存储引擎比较,MyISAM具有检查和修复表格的大多数工具. MyISAM表格可以被压缩,而且它们支持全文搜索.它们不是事务安全的,而且也不支持外键。如果事物回滚将造成不完全回滚,不具有原子性。如
MySQL NDB Cluster是MySQL 适合于分布式计算环境的高实用、高冗余版本。它采用了NDB Cluster 存储引擎,允许在1个 Cluster 中运行多个MySQL服务器。MySQL NDB Cluster是一种技术,该技术允许在无共享的系统中部署“内存中”数据库的 Cluster 。通过无共享体系结构,系统能够使用廉价的硬件,而且对软硬件无特殊要求。此外,由于每个组件有自己的内...
转载
2021-08-09 16:27:53
1588阅读
MySQL NDB Cluster是MySQL 适合于分布式计算环境的高
转载
2022-04-11 16:33:43
1504阅读
**MySQL优缺点分析**
作为一名经验丰富的开发者,我们经常会在项目中使用MySQL这一关系型数据库。MySQL作为一个开源数据库管理系统,在实际应用中具有一定的优势和劣势。下面我将就MySQL的优缺点进行详细分析,并给出相关代码示例,帮助你更好地了解 MySQL。
**MySQL 优点:**
1. **稳定可靠**:MySQL 是经过广泛应用和验证的数据库,稳定性高,有许多企业在生产环
原创
2024-05-29 11:17:30
250阅读
# 实现Mysql InnoDB cluster 缺点解决方案
## 概述
在使用Mysql InnoDB cluster时,可能会遇到一些问题或者缺点。本文将介绍如何解决这些问题,帮助你更好地使用Mysql InnoDB cluster。
### 流程概览
下表展示了解决Mysql InnoDB cluster 缺点的整个流程:
| 步骤 | 操作 |
| ------ | ------
原创
2024-04-13 05:28:32
187阅读
目录一、下载FastDB & GigaBASE: Object-Relational Database Management Systems二、介绍1、引言‘2、查询语言(Query Language)3、查询优化的具体实现4、结束语一、下载FastDB & GigaBASE: Object-Relational Database Management Systemshttp://